Double Dragon II Coming to Xbox Live Arcade, Doesn't Look Like Double DragonSide-scrolling beat 'em up Double Dragon II: The Revenge, the arcade version is being remade for Xbox Live Arcade. Good news so far, right? What may be less exciting is the 3D remake of the arcade original, which looks... well...

Based on Co-optimus' preview of the game now known as Double Dragon II: Wander of the Dragons, the modern-day update is lacking in a little visual charm, bordering on bland. Fortunately, it looks a bit better in motion, with an expanded move set and combo system.

The price (1200 Microsoft Points) may turn you off if the visuals haven't and unanswered questions about the availability of online cooperative play may kill Double Dragon II: Wander of the Dragons's hopes of getting many of us back into Billy and Jimmy beat 'em up mode.

Wander of the Dragons looks like it has potential for mindless, enemy stomping thrills, but we'll have to wait until September to give it a spin.
